- The biblical meaning of work is multifaceted and includes the following12:
- Deeds leading to planned results, both by God and people.
- God's works are His acts and deeds in creating, saving, and sustaining.
- When work is done in and for the Lord, it benefits others and honors God.
- It is in creative activity that we externalize our identities as people made in the image of God.
- Our identity transcends our work, and if we do not derive our identity from our relationship with the Lord, our work will tend to shape and define us.
